Release of 6 people arrested during the riots

Friday, the Judge Instructor Jean Osner Petit Papa, ordered the release of 6 people arrested during the riots of July 6, 7 and 8, 2018 https://www.haitilibre.com/en/news-25055-haiti-flash-heavy-balance-of-riots.html After stating that there was no charge retained against Claude Griffon, Florestal Gregory, Warrior Danis Steevens, Michel Marie-Line, Pierre Ronald Saintine and Rosemond Ronald. Jean Osner Petit Papa declared them innocent.

Les Cayes UrbHaiti project : Nearly 1.4 million dollars

A meeting was held at the Town Hall of Les Cayes at the initiative of the Catholic Relief Services (CRS) around the UrbHaiti project, funded by the European Union, which includes 3 major projects up to 750,000.00 Euros for the services of base and 10 micro projects of 50,000 Dollars to mitigate risks and disasters. The CRS and the Mayor of Les Cayes agreed on a schedule to set up a technical committee involving the various sectors and notables of the city, the Community Base Organizations (CBOs) and the city delegates in the choice of projects; Prioritize four neighborhoods during the meeting of Thursday, August 30, 2018 and organize one or more open days to inform the population of the city of Les Cayes and involve them in the choice of projects.

The Ti Manman Cheri program on Turtle Island

The "Ti Manman Cheri" program is taking continue its route on Turtle Island where the agents of the Economic and Social Assistance Fund (FAES) went this week to distribute vouchers to the mothers of the children of several national schools, after doing the same work at the National School of Croix Saint Joseph in Port-de-Paix.

Strengthen the capacity of IMED

Thursday was the official launching ceremony of the Institutional Strengthening Support Project of the Mobile Institute for Democratic Education (IMED) supported by the Minujusth Human Rights Department. This project aims to strengthen IMED's capacity to enable Civil Society to observe, report on human rights violations and advocate for the respect of human rights. and that victims can be assisted, directed and protected against recurrent violations.

Follow-up of projects by the Caribbean Bank

Monica La Bennett, Vice President of the Caribbean Development Bank (BCD) at the head of a delegation, visited former projects financed by the Bank as part of the implementation of the Participatory Urban Community Development Project (PRODEPUR) in collaboration with the World Bank and the Government of Haiti / Monetary Office of Development Assistance Programs (BMPAD). These projects were executed by the Pan American Development Foundation (PADF), in the neighborhoods of Delmas 32, Simmond-Pelé and Cité Soleil respectively.
